- [ ] Step 7: Archive cold storage buckets (Glacierline tier). Confirm both ceremony witnesses are present, verify bucket manifests match the Oxbow ledger, then seal the archive key shares. Plugin authors may observe but not handle shares. Once sealed, the archive index itself is encrypted and can only be reopened with the passphrase below.

vault phrase of badup-hahig = tamael-aldael-kelmir-istael-fenok-istwyn-tamius-jorath-oliion

Handover: restock planner (FillStation)

For support: I'm passing the vending-machine restock planner to Dario. The planner recomputes routes nightly; if a machine reports stale inventory, re-run the sync job rather than editing rows by hand. Alerts go to the ops channel. Most tickets trace back to misconfigured depots, so check those first. The planner currently runs with these configuration values:

config for yajep-tafof:
[rusath]
team = julmir
access_code = ac_fe37fd
host = rusath.novactech.test
port = 8000
owner = pelmir.weneth
peer = oliwyn.olvarqdyn.internal

## Limits & Quotas

Welcome to the Murmur Gallery audio-guide team! The app streams narration clips, so we cap concurrent streams per visitor and throttle downloads on museum wifi to keep things smooth during school-trip rushes. Most quotas live in one config module. The values currently in production are these.

tuning table, bawip-bahap:
BUDGETS = {
    "gorir": 473,
    "kelius": 138,
    "silion": 345,
    "aldmir": 429,
    "tamdor": 108,
    "oliir": 987,
    "belius": 539,
}

Subject: Deep-link cut-over complete

Hi Marisol,

The switchover of mobile deep-link routing from LinkSpool to our in-house Waypath resolver finished at 02:10 last night. Old short links redirect through the shim for 90 days; new links resolve natively. Crash rate held flat, and the Android fallback path was exercised twice without incident. Analytics tagging carried over cleanly. For the release record, here are the resolver's active configuration values.

config for tagef-bahip:
eliael:
  pin: 1924
  tenant: gilys
  seal: seal_b0b00e0d
  metrics_host: metrics.eliael.ferraforge.corp
  standby_team: gilok
  escalation: ulair-ulaael
  nonce: 965f6e